A TikTok user sparks debate over the connection between gifted programs and CIA training.

Anna Mills, who goes by @annamillsxo23 on TikTok, is at the center of this buzz. She’s been sharing old schoolwork and assignments from her childhood, and it’s got people talking.
In her videos, she flips through a binder filled with assignments from the ’90s. She’s like, “What were we being trained for?” It’s a fair question, right?
These gifted programs have always had students working on different stuff, but Mills’ worksheets are raising eyebrows. They included things like code-breaking, graph plotting, and even learning sign language and Russian.
A lot of the lessons focused on creative problem-solving, and some even mentioned aliens or Russian culture. This has led some to think there’s a link to the CIA’s Gateway Program from the ’80s, which was all about exploring human consciousness.
People are sharing their own experiences too. One TikTok user, Rachel, recalled taking meditation-type tests with audio tapes. It’s all a bit eerie, especially since many former students can’t remember much about their time in these programs.
Some are even questioning why their memories are so fuzzy. “Why do most of us only ‘faintly’ remember any of it?” one person asked.
While the theories are intriguing, there’s no solid proof that these gifted programs were connected to the CIA. It’s just a fascinating conversation starter for now.
